What's not so great: Oven failed after one day
We loved the range for about a day until the oven and broiler stopped working. Best Buy contracted with A&E Factory Service (SEARS) to make the warranty repair. A&E were responsive and good but it took them 3 visits to repair the oven. One visit to diagnose the problem. On the next visit they replaced the oven circuit board and that got the broiler working but not the oven. On the final visit they replaced the gas valve and now the oven works again.. The digital controls are well laid out and the oven
heats quickly and maintains an even temperature. Convection works well too. Burners have lots of heat and control. Next time I would buy the dual fuel version instead of a gas oven.

My new KitchenAid Gas Range (Architect Series II) is my first brand-new stove, and it has everything: looks like a professional chef's range and produces a flame that's adjustable from very high heat to very low. There's also a reversible grate to support my wok.
Besides that, my new stove has a convection oven that makes everything I cook taste tender, juicy and better than my old ordinary oven. Because it blows the heat around the food, it uses lower temperatures and less time than nonconvection ovens. I can also delay the start of cooking, so my food is ready when I get home from work.
Below the oven is a warming drawer that works for heating plates, holding hot bread and side dishes, and keeping dinner warm during unexpected delays.
Last, but not least, the oven cleans itself! What a blessing for getting rid of those baked-on spatters and fruit pie spills.
